PMI Rises To 62.5 Percent

April 9, 2004
Economic activity in the manufacturing sector grew in March for the 10th consecutive month, while the overall economy grew for the 29th consecutive month, according to the latest survey of purchasing managers by the Institute for Supply Management (ISM), Tempe, Ariz. ISM’s Purchasing Managers Index is 62.5 percent in March, an increase of 1.1 percentage points when compared to 61.4 percent in February.

“The manufacturing sector had another good month in March as the PMI has now been above the 60 percent mark for five consecutive months. Both new orders and production remain strong and have significant momentum going into the second quarter,” said Norbert J. Ore, chair of the Institute for Supply Management Manufacturing Business Survey Committee and group director, strategic sourcing and procurement, Georgia Pacific Corp.

Comments from purchasing and supply managers are focused on higher energy and material costs, the availability of certain metals and the weaker dollar. As leadtimes extend, their concerns are shifting from cost issues to availability.

“The first quarter was very strong for the manufacturing sector and the economy overall,” added Ore. “Our survey respondents generally indiate that business is quite strong.”

All reporting industries reported growth. These include industrial and commercial equipment, electronic components and equipment, fabricated metals, transportation and equipment.

Ore said several commodities, including aluminum; steel; and steel, cold rolled are in short supply. Commodities reported up in price include aluminum; copper and copper products; electrical components; steel; steel, cold rolled; steel, galvanized; steel, flat rolled; steel, hot rolled; steel pipe, and steel scrap.
